DICHLOROACETIC ACID


1. Product Identification
Synonyms: Acetic acid, dichloro-; DCA; Bichloroacetic Acid; Dichloroethanoic Acid
CAS No.: 79-43-6
Molecular Weight: 128.94
Chemical Formula: C2H2Cl2O2
Product Codes: 2-19547

Potential Health Effects
----------------------------------
Information on the human health effects from exposure to this substance is limited.
Inhalation: Corrosive. Extremely destructive to tissues of the mucous membranes and upper respiratory
tract. Symptoms may include burning sensation, coughing, wheezing, laryngitis, shortness of breath,
headache, nausea and vomiting. Inhalation may be fatal as a result of spasm inflammation and edema of
the larynx and bronchi, chemical pneumonitis and pulmonary edema.
Ingestion: Extremely destructive to tissues.
Skin Contact: Extremely destructive to skin.
Eye Contact: Extremely destructive to eyes.
Chronic Exposure: No information found.

4. First Aid Measures
Inhalation: Remove to fresh air. If not breathing, give artificial respiration. If breathing is difficult, give
oxygen. Call a physician.
Ingestion: If swallowed, DO NOT INDUCE VOMITING. Give large quantities of water. Never give
anything by mouth to an unconscious person. Get medical attention immediately.
Skin Contact: In case of contact, immediately flush skin with plenty of water for at least 15 minutes while
removing contaminated clothing and shoes. Wash clothing before reuse. Thoroughly clean shoes before
reuse. Get medical attention immediately.
Eye Contact: Immediately flush eyes with plenty of water for at least 15 minutes, lifting lower and upper
eyelids occasionally. Get medical attention immediately.

6. Accidental Release Measures
Ventilate area of leak or spill. Remove all sources of ignition. Wear appropriate personal protective
equipment as specified in Section 8. Isolate hazard area. Keep unnecessary and unprotected personnel
from entering. Use water spray to dilute spill to a nonflammable mixture. Contain and recover liquid
when possible. Collect liquid in an appropriate container or absorb with an inert material (e. g.,
vermiculite, dry sand, earth), and place in a chemical waste container. Use non-sparking tools and
equipment. Do not use combustible materials, such as saw dust. Do not flush to sewer!


7. Handling and Storage
Keep in a tightly closed container, stored in a cool, dry, ventilated area. Protect against physical damage.
Isolate from incompatible substances. Containers of this material may be hazardous when empty since
they retain product residues (vapors, liquid); observe all warnings and precautions listed for the product.

9. Physical and Chemical Properties
Product may solidify at room temperature.
Appearance: Clear, colorless liquid.
Odor: Pungent odor.
Solubility: Soluble in water.
Specific Gravity: 1.563
pH: No information found.
% Volatiles by volume @ 21C (70F): No information found.
Boiling Point: 194C (381F)
Melting Point: 9 - 11C (48 - 52F)
Vapor Density (Air=1): 4.5
Vapor Pressure (mm Hg): 1 @ 44C (111F)
Evaporation Rate (BuAc=1): No information found.


10. Stability and Reactivity
Stability: Stable under ordinary conditions of use and storage.
Hazardous Decomposition Products: May emit oxides of carbon and hydrogen chloride gas when heated
to decomposition.
Hazardous Polymerization: Will not occur.
Incompatibilities: Strong oxidizers, bases, and reducing agents.
Conditions to Avoid: Heat and moisture.


11. Toxicological Information
Oral rat LD50: 2820 mg/kg Skin rabbit LD50: 510 mg/kg. Draize, skin, rabbit: 2mg/24hr severe. Draize,
eye, rabbit: 50ug open severe. Investigated as a tumorigen, mutagen, reproductive effector.
